Glazing To Perfection

Have you ever looked at a cake and stopped to stare at it? Well, that’s what a perfectly glazed cake does to you. The art of glazing refers to giving the cake an ultra smooth coated finish that is nothing short of the epitome of perfection. The finesse and patience this takes is a skill you can only gather from practice.

Adopting Healthy Alternatives  

No doubt exotic pastries taste great but they also come with some cons. Mostly, it’s health related in the form of excess sugar, cream or egg recipes in case someone is allergic or vegan. Implementing healthy alternatives while keeping the quality and taste intact is the key here. For example, using jaggery instead of artificial powder sugar.

Floral Flavours

Speaking of health benefits, floral flavours are steadily making their way to cakes. Some of them have become increasingly popular such as rose flavored cake, edible flower cake and vanilla. It’s not just their picturesque presentation but also their delicious taste that’s making them so popular.

Naked Tall Cakes

Naked tall cakes are usually minimal and you might have seen them on occasions such as a wedding reception. These typically include various layers of freshly baked cake and a smooth exterior frosting to seal the deal. They look extremely classy, making it the go-to option for special parties.
